Sign In — Free (10 views/day)Ken-Crest Housing PA 99 Inc, founded in 1999, is a small nonprofit in the Housing & Shelter sector that reported $151K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Expenses of $173K exceeded revenue, resulting in a 14% operating deficit.
OWN AND OPERATE A NON-PROFIT HOUSING PROJECT FOR PEOPLE WITH DISABILITIES UNDER SECTION 811 CAPITAL ADVANCE PROGRAM OF U.S. DEPARTMENT OF HOUSING AND URBAN DEVELOPMENT.
